How 20 Minutes Can Improve Your Creativity and Build Real Artistic Skills

Here’s a secret about making art: you don’t have to block hours out of your day to improve your skills. Consistent art sessions, as short as 20 minutes, can add up to real skill-building. That’s a relief, especially if you want to exercise your creativity but have limited time during your day. You can easily replace 20 minutes of doom-scrolling on your phone with an art session and feel better for it.

There are a few benefits of short art sessions. One is a lack of excuses. Spending 20 minutes a day on art sounds much more manageable than even an hour, which makes it easier to commit to—and harder to ignore. This leads to a second benefit: consistency. When you’re consistent with your practice, it becomes a habit. You’ll find that when you haven’t drawn or painted that day, something is missing. And finally, the more you practice, the more small goals you’ll achieve. It will give you momentum to keep going and build your skills.
